Battery of 12 driving tests, majority of which represented new designs, were constructed in desert; 180 subjects were divided into five groups on basis of number of hours members of each group drove truck on fatigue course after initial test and prior to retest on battery; fatigue periods were of 0, 1, 3, 7, or 9 hr duration; pre-and post-fatigue test results were correlated with hours of fatigue driving where hours-of-driving served as test criterion; test-retest reliabilities ranged from 0.35 to 0.88; validities reached maximum of 0.38.
Analysis of complex skill -- Vehicle driving
